The Impact of Temperature on Paint Application



When you're preparing a commercial outside paint task, the temperature can considerably impact just how well the paint adheres and dries.

Preferably, you intend to repaint when temperatures range in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's also chilly, the paint may not treat properly, causing concerns like peeling or fracturing.

On the flip side, if it's also hot, the paint can dry out also quickly, avoiding correct adhesion and resulting in an irregular coating.

You ought to also take into consideration the moment of day; morning or late afternoon uses cooler temperature levels, which can be much more beneficial.

Moisture and Its Effect on Drying Times



Temperature level isn't the only ecological aspect that influences your business external paint job; moisture plays a considerable role as well. High humidity levels can slow down drying times dramatically, impacting the overall high quality of your paint work.



When the air is filled with dampness, the paint takes longer to heal, which can bring about problems like bad adhesion and a greater risk of mold development. If you're painting on a specifically humid day, be prepared for extensive delay times in between layers.

Best Seasons for Commercial Exterior Painting Projects



What's the best time of year for your business exterior painting tasks?

Springtime and early fall are typically your best options. Throughout these seasons, temperatures are mild, and moisture levels are commonly lower, developing optimal conditions for paint application and drying.

Avoid summer's intense heat, which can trigger paint to dry also promptly, causing poor adhesion and finish. Likewise, wintertime's chilly temperatures can prevent appropriate drying out and healing, risking the long life of your paint job.

Aim for days with temperatures between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for optimum outcomes. Keep in mind to inspect the regional weather prediction for rainfall, as wet conditions can ruin your job.

Planning around these variables ensures your painting job runs efficiently and lasts much longer.
